LILY'S KITCHEN Woofbrush Dental Dog Chews combine natural, organic ingredients with a unique spongey texture to effectively remove plaque at the gumline. Developed with pet dental experts, these grain-free, vegetarian chews support daily oral health for small breed dogs aged 6 months and up, delivering a fresh breath boost and a satisfying chew experience.

My small cockerpoo has had trouble digesting other dental chews that I have tried resulting in loose bowel movements and syphoning tummy noises suggesting abdominal discomfort, so I discontinued feeding them to her. I feed her Lilly’s kitchen lamb wet food on which she is thriving so when seeing these advertised I thought them worth a try. She really enjoys them as they provide a good gnaw, and after having them daily for a week there have been no ill effects. Hopefully they will be cleaning her teeth a bit so I shall continue with them, notwithstanding that they are expensive at nearly a pound per chew.
